Importance of the Topic
The rapid expansion of hemp-based products in medicinal and recreational markets has underscored the need for robust analytical testing. Comprehensive testing ensures product quality, consumer safety, and compliance with evolving state and federal regulations. Hemp laboratories require reliable methods to quantify cannabinoids, profile terpenes, detect pesticide residues, measure residual solvents, assess heavy metals, determine moisture content, and identify mycotoxins.
Study Objectives and Overview
This article presents a portfolio of turnkey analytical solutions designed to support hemp testing laboratories from seed to sale. The goals include:
- Defined workflows for potency, terpene, pesticide, solvent, metal, moisture, and mycotoxin analyses.
- Integration of instrumentation, software, consumables, and service support.
- Scalable platforms to accommodate routine QC and advanced research needs.
Methodology and Instrumentation
The proposed methods leverage industry-standard and advanced analytical technologies:
- High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) for cannabinoid potency, with three method packages—high throughput (<8 min), high sensitivity (<10 min), and high resolution (<30 min)—using certified reference mixtures and automated analyzers.
- Gas Chromatography–Mass Spectrometry (GC–MS) for terpene profiling, employing Shimadzu GCMS-TQ8050 NX or GCMS-QP2020 NX with HS-20 headspace sampler and spectral libraries to identify over 3,000 compounds.
- Liquid Chromatography–Tandem MS (LC–MS/MS) for pesticide screening, achieving ultralow detection limits for 211 targeted pesticides in under 12 min on the LCMS-8050 triple quadrupole system.
- Optional GC–MS/MS for volatile or problematic pesticides and residual solvent quantitation using the GCMS-TQ8050 with headspace sampling.
- Inductively Coupled Plasma–Mass Spectrometry (ICP–MS) on the ICPMS-2030 for trace heavy metals analysis following acid digestion.
- Moisture analysis via halogen moisture balances (MOC63u and MOC-120H) for rapid determination of water content in hemp products.
- Mycotoxin detection using LCMS-8050 to achieve regulatory compliance for fungal toxins.
- Data management and compliance with LabSolutions DB/CS software supporting FDA 21 CFR Part 11 and Annex 11 requirements.
- Advanced research platforms, including online SFE-SFC-LC–MS/MS, MALDI-TOF, and high-resolution Q-TOF systems.
Main Results and Discussion
The integration of specialized methods and instrumentation yields the following benefits:
- Potency assays deliver accurate quantitation of 10–11 cannabinoids with minimal method development and robust throughput.
- Terpene profiling provides detailed aroma and flavor compound resolution, supporting homeopathic effect studies.
- Pesticide workflows achieve comprehensive coverage with LODs meeting or exceeding current regulatory thresholds.
- Residual solvent analyses ensure consumer safety by detecting solvent residues at trace levels.
- ICP–MS enables sensitive heavy metal screening without additional sample prep accessories.
- Moisture and mycotoxin testing deliver rapid, reliable data to prevent spoilage and ensure product purity.

Future Trends and Opportunities
Emerging areas that will shape hemp analysis include:
- Greater automation and integration of sample preparation and data workflows.
- Expansion of high-resolution mass spectrometry for untargeted profiling.
- Implementation of supercritical fluid techniques for greener extraction and separation.
- Adoption of MALDI-TOF for rapid microbial contamination screening.
- Development of in situ and real-time monitoring tools for cultivation and processing control.
